" A tastefully presented older style 3 bedroom semi detached house offers scope for a single storey extension and/or loft conversion (subject to planning permission being granted), situated in an elevated cul de sac location in the village of North Holmwood. The property enjoys a southerly aspect rear garden that has been landscaped and has rear pedestrian access direct to the village centre. North Holmwood village has a local shop, hairdresser, church and community hall however the more major town of Dorking with its comprehensive range of shopping facilities, educational and leisure complex is some one a half miles to the north together with Dorking station providing mainline services to London, the M25 can be accessed via Junction 9, Leatherhead.
